The P6SMB39CA TRTB is a surface mount, bi-directional Transient Voltage Suppressor (TVS) diode manufactured by Fagor. It's designed to protect sensitive electronic equipment from voltage transients induced by lightning, inductive load switching, and electrostatic discharge (ESD). The 'TRTB' likely designates a specific packaging type or reel configuration for automated assembly.

Features:
- Glass passivated junction
- Bi-directional TVS
- Excellent clamping capability
- Low incremental surge resistance
- Fast response time: Typically less than 1.0 ps from 0 Volts to BV min
- High temperature soldering guaranteed: 260°C/10 seconds at terminals
- Plastic material has UL flammability classification 94V-0
- Matte Tin Lead-free plated

Technical Specifications:
The P6SMB39CA is a bi-directional TVS diode. The stand-off voltage is 39V. The breakdown voltage is typically 43.3V to 47.8V. The clamping voltage is typically 62.9V @ 9.5A. The peak pulse power dissipation is 600W. It operates over a temperature range of -55°C to +150°C. The package is SMA/DO-214AA. The maximum reverse leakage current is typically less than 5uA at the working voltage.
